In 2023, the New York Times published a report detailing their investigation into Neville Roy Singham, an American Marxist based in Shanghai who, according to the Times, “works closely with the Chinese government media machine and is financing its propaganda worldwide.”
At the time, Singham had funneled “at least” $275 million into leftist US nonprofits like Code Pink, The People’s Forum, BreakThrough News, the Justice and Education Fund, and Tricontinental: Institute for Social Research. The Times documented that these groups are interconnected, sharing staff and content; the Times writes that Singham also “shares office space â and his groups share staff members â with a company whose mission is educating foreigners about “the miracles that China has created on the world stage.”

The Bitcoin Policy Institute reported recently that the “Party for Socialism and Liberation (PSL), a Marxist-Leninist groupâ¦whose stated mission is to dismantle American capitalism,” is “deeply enmeshed” in local groups fighting against data center construction. The groups leaders come from Singhams non-profit network and the PSL has been effective in delaying or blocking about $24 billion in proposed AI-infrastructure investment.
BPI writes, “The Singham networks campaign against American AI has been years in the making”; it catalogs the “seeding [of] anti-data-center talking points well before the local fights began.” For instance, the PSL’s Communist paper, “Liberation News”, published a piece in 2025 blaming rising electricity bills in Illinois to the data center boom, declaring the facilities “are generating massive profits for some, but leave workers with more bills and devastate the environment.”
